The Lung Cancer Score in 32976, Sebastian, Florida is 44 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

86.56 percent of the population in 32976 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 56.68 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 5.62 percent of the residents in 32976 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.26 members with about 1.93 cars available per household.

An estimate of 91.99 percent of the residents in 32976 has some form of health insurance. 69.99 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 55.86 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 32976 would have to travel an average of 2.67 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Sebastian River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 32976, Sebastian, Florida.

As of , an estimate of 8,759 residents live in 32976 with a median age of 68.2 years. 2.76 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 60.95 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 31.83 percent of the residents in 32976 is currently married, and 13.35 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 32976 is $4,452.42.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 32976 is approximately $487. The median household spends about 10.94 percent of their income on housing.
